Intro Synergy Launches Neta V Ev

25/10/2023 07:38 PM

KUALA LUMPUR, Oct 25 (Bernama) -- Intro Synergy Sdn Bhd, a wholly owned subsidiary of GoAuto Group Sdn Bhd, has officially launched the electric vehicle (EV) model, Neta V, to the Malaysian market.

The sole distributor of Neta, one of China’s EV brands, said Neta V will be available for booking nationwide with an on-the-road price of RM100,000.

“The car comes with a five-year or 150,000 kilometre (km) warranty for general components, an eight-year or 180,000 km warranty for EV high voltage components including battery and on-board charger, and a 10-year or 200,000 km warranty for the body,” the company said in a statement.

It said Neta V is available in five unique colours, namely sakura pink, sky blue, moonlight green, midnight grey, cyan and white storm.

With 380 km of range on a single charge, the model's electric motor produces up to 95 kilowatts of power and a maximum torque of 160 Newton metres, allowing the EV to accelerate from 0 to 50 kilometres per hour (km/h) in just 3.9 seconds and reaching a maximum speed of 120 km/h (based on actual tests).

“The Neta V supports both fast and slow charging and is equipped with a battery management system optimisation which shortens charging times, achieving 20 per cent to 80 per cent charge in approximately 30 minutes through direct current fast charging.

“It also is equipped with HEPT 3.0 thermostatic battery management system, which utilises liquid cooling to maintain battery efficiency with minimal cooling energy,” it said.

According to the statement, Neta has also established a network of dealers and service centres in the Klang Valley, as well as the northern, southern and eastern regions of Peninsula Malaysia, and also in Sabah.

The brand plans to further expand this network to cater for more customers as the brand gains momentum within the market segment.

GoAuto Group executive chairman Datuk SM Azli SM Nasimuddin Kamal said Neta and Intro Synergy are committed to playing their role in helping consumers transition to electric-based transportation modes as the country drives towards carbon neutrality by the year 2050.

“As Malaysia works its way through issues such as subsidy rationalisation and other energy transitions, the introduction of the Neta brand to the Malaysian market signifies our commitment as a local industry player towards contributing to the national agenda from our standpoint,” he said.

He said via partnerships and its own group investments, the group is committed to expanding its operations to allow consumers access to more EV products and is currently planning to undertake manufacturing and assembly of various types of EVs at its new assembly plant in Negeri Sembilan.
